goraft / raft
UNMAINTAINED: A Go implementation of the Raft distributed consensus protocol.
☆2,429Updated 9 years ago
Alternatives and similar repositories for raft:
Users that are interested in raft are comparing it to the libraries listed below
- The LevelDB key-value database in the Go programming language.☆1,153Updated 8 years ago
- Consistent hash package for Go.☆970Updated 5 years ago
- A feature complete and high performance multi-group Raft library in Go.☆5,153Updated 9 months ago
- Native ZooKeeper client for Go. This project is no longer maintained. Please use https://github.com/go-zookeeper/zk instead.☆1,641Updated 4 years ago
- gorocksdb is a Go wrapper for RocksDB☆954Updated last year
- A port of the LMAX Disruptor to the Go language.☆1,393Updated last year
- A high performance NoSQL Database Server powered by Go☆4,116Updated last year
- A go implementation of the Paxos algorithm☆343Updated 6 years ago
- Distributed transactional NoSQL database, Redis protocol compatible using tikv as backend☆1,435Updated 2 years ago
- LogCabin is a distributed storage system built on Raft that provides a small amount of highly replicated, consistent storage. It is a rel…☆1,920Updated 9 months ago
- Skynet is a framework for distributed services in Go.☆1,974Updated 7 years ago
- Raft backend implementation using BoltDB☆677Updated last month
- distributed file system(small file storage) writen in golang.☆1,596Updated 4 years ago
- Connection pool for Go's net.Conn interface☆1,366Updated 6 years ago
- LevelDB key/value database in Go.☆6,241Updated 11 months ago
- BTree provides a simple, ordered, in-memory data structure for Go programs.☆4,056Updated 7 months ago
- An implementation of failpoints for Golang.☆848Updated 10 months ago
- Golang implementation of the Raft consensus protocol☆8,530Updated last week
- a generic object pool for golang☆1,236Updated last year
- Micro-service framework in Go☆3,267Updated 6 years ago
- Sources for my PhD dissertation on the Raft consensus algorithm☆1,030Updated 8 years ago
- Elastic Key-Value Storage With Strong Consistency and Reliability☆529Updated 4 years ago
- A reference use of Hashicorp's Raft implementation☆1,019Updated 3 weeks ago
- foreman clone written in go language☆2,541Updated 4 months ago
- A reference implementation for using the go-raft library for distributed consensus.☆295Updated 9 years ago
- Golang package for gossip based membership and failure detection☆3,801Updated last month
- Efficient token-bucket-based rate limiter package.☆2,842Updated last year
- Go port of Coda Hale's Metrics library☆3,473Updated 2 weeks ago
- kiteq is a distributed mq framework☆790Updated last year
- Stochastic flame graph profiler for Go programs☆3,959Updated 6 years ago